For this wild offering, we rack our flagship farmhouse ale, Trillium, to age in neutral oak casks with a house Bug Blend of yeasts. Appearance is bright yellow-golden with light, gentle carbonation. Moderately funky and slightly tart, but not sour, Wild Trillium expresses subtle tannic structure with delicate notes of light citrus, pepper, and hay. Mouthfeel is soft and the finish is dry, crisp and tannic.

MALT: Pilsner, Wheat, Flaked Wheat

HOPS: US Goldings, Columbus

A - Nice light haze on a bright gold body. Pours with 2 fingers of white head. Ok retention and low lace. Nice carbonation in the glass.

S - Tart kiwi, lemon rind, fresh cut grass, and bready yeast.

T - Waxy. Lightly tart with bitter herbs and lemon pith. Raw dandilion and tannin finish.

M - Soft medium-light frame with nice carbonation.

O - A nice summer beer, but a shade too waxy.
